The 1975 Brussels summit was the third NATO summit bringing the leaders of member nations together at the same time. The formal sessions and informal meetings in Brussels, Belgium took place on 29–30 May 1975.[http://www.nato.int/issues/summits/index.html#agendas NATO summit meetings] {{webarchive|url=https://web.archive.org/web/20090509014601/http://www.nato.int/issues/summits/index.html |date=2009-05-09 }} This event was only the fourth meeting of the NATO heads of state following the ceremonial signing of the North Atlantic Treaty on 4 April 1949.Thomas, Ian Q.R.
